Commercial Mold Remediation Service
Mold Remediation in Your Building Dealing with mold is often a three-step process. First, analyze the situation. Second, prevent the mold from growing. Third, clean it up.
IAQ Solutions
specializes in structural and HVAC mold (or microbial) decontamination
of commercial office buildings, universities, hospitals, and industrial
facilities. We realize that these structures vary in level of
contamination and the occupant's sensitivity levels are different;
hence, IAQ Solutions' technicians provide personal attention to
determine the appropriate remediation strategy before starting work in
your building. This strategy includes a highly unique mold
decontamination service for sensitive environments, as well as those
occupants that suffer from asthma and allergies.
Mold is mostly found in a building's roof, floor, and wall cavities. IAQ Solutions
focuses on successful cleaning of microbially contaminated HVAC systems
and interior structures, such as walls, ceilings, and floors.
Precautions taken before the remediation help us guarantee that our
services will be effective. Service technicians carefully build
containment structures, in effect sealing off the contaminated area.
This process prevents further spread of the contamination throughout the
rest of the structure. Other nationally approved steps in our
remediation process include: HEPA vacuuming, disinfecting, sealing, and
documenting all of our data.
Mold contamination does not mean
office materials or personal effects need to be thrown away. In many
instances, we are required to remove and dispose of contaminated
materials, such as carpeting, walls, flooring, ceiling tiles,
furnishings, or construction debris. This removal process is, again,
done under containment to ensure the health of the occupants. If there
are certain materials that the facility manager or occupant does, in
fact, wish to keep (even though they may have been contaminated), our
technicians will thoroughly decontaminate the item before returning it
to the occupied space.
